lights.exe (Lights) - Details
The lights.exe provides a system tray icon that gives you 'at a glance' information with regard to the status of your modem. This process should be left running unless it is suspected of causing problems for your computer.
lights.exe is flagged as a system process and does not appear to be a security risk. However, removing Lights may adversly impact your system.
The Process Server database currently registers lights.exe to Microsoft.
This is part of Microsoft Windows.
